    The SAP error message /CFG/ACTIVATION140: There is no view left to add typically occurs during the activation of a configuration view in the SAP system. This error indicates that the system is unable to find any additional views that can be added to the configuration you are trying to activate. Here are some potential causes, solutions, and related information for this error:
    Causes:
    
    No Views Available: The most straightforward cause is that there are no more views available for the configuration you are trying to activate.
    Incorrect Configuration: The configuration might be incomplete or incorrectly set up, leading to the system not recognizing any views to add.
    Authorization Issues: Sometimes, the user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or activate certain configurations.
    Technical Issues: There could be underlying technical issues, such as inconsistencies in the database or problems with the transport layer.
